Itinerary
DAY 1
We leave Perth for Broomehill and the start of the Holland Track.
From there we travel to Nowernalup Tank, one of John Holland’s first stops and walk in to view the commemorative plaque.
We lunch somewhere on the road and stop at spots of significance, such as Holland Rock, Silver Wattle Hill and Dragon Rocks, tracing Holland’s steps and examining the water sources he found. Some of the gnamma holes might still have their original capping on them.
Our overnight stop is at Hyden, with the wonderful hospitality of the Wave Rock Resort.

DAY 3
Continuing along the Holland Track we explore Agnes Gnamma Hole, Diamond and Thursday Rocks, and Pigeon Hole, depending on accessibility.
Victoria Rock is a magnificent example of the rockholes of the Holland Track and we take time to climb it.
On our way to the end of the Track, we visit Gnarlbine Rock which was one of the principal water sources for the original Coolgardie goldrush at Bailey’s Find.

DAY 4
We travel out to Burra Rocks/Cave Hill Reserve and take in more examples of the significance of the granite gnamma rockholes and their importance in opening up this area to explorers, prospectors and farmers.
Exploring the Cave Hill Woodlines we follow some of the many kilometres of railway tramlines that crisscrossed this area in the early days of Gold mining in the area. There’s also the chance to search for ancient indigineous cave art.
